NVIDIA is looking for a Senior CPU Tooling and Design Automation Engineer to help drive the development of CPU technology for architectures used for artificial intelligence (AI), deep learning (DL), high-performance computing (HPC), cloud service providers (CSP), gaming, virtual reality, and autonomous vehicles. The role is part of the CPU tooling and design automation team.
Responsibilities
- Work on computer-aided design (CAD) tools development for CPU and fabric teams to improve efficiency.
- Develop Network-on-Chip (NoC) and system-on-chip (SoC) tooling in close collaboration with architects, chip leads, and designers.
- Advance NoC and SoC tooling to enable productivity improvements.
- Understand the chip design flow and translate this knowledge into feature requirements for tooling.
- Develop complex automation involving advanced graph algorithms to enable more push-button solutions.
- Collaborate with teams throughout the company, including architecture, RTL, and physical design teams, to implement cross-team solutions and achieve project targets.
- Drive cross-team methodologies for deploying the tooling.
Requirements
- Bachelor's degree in Computer Engineering or Electrical Engineering, or equivalent experience.
- 5+ years of relevant work experience in EDA tool development and flow development.
- Proficiency with EDA-style databases and basic graph algorithms.
- Experience with build flows such as Make and scripting languages.
- Experience deploying in-house EDA tools across groups and solving flow issues.
- Strong interpersonal, communication, and teamwork skills.
- A drive to continuously learn and expand architectural breadth and depth.
Preferred Qualifications
- Background in Network-on-Chip tooling.
- Experience with netlist-level tools.
